知识问答
如何高效运用雷霆服务器提升性能?
雷霆服务器是高性能的计算平台,广泛应用于科学计算、数据分析和云计算等领域,本文将详细介绍如何使用雷霆服务器,包括基本操作、性能优化以及常见问题解答。
雷霆服务器的基本操作
1. 登录雷霆服务器
使用SSH登录:通过SSH客户端(如PuTTY或OpenSSH)连接到雷霆服务器,输入以下命令:
ssh username@server_ip
其中username
为你的账号名,server_ip
为雷霆服务器的IP地址。
使用远程桌面连接:如果你需要图形界面,可以使用远程桌面工具(如RDP)进行连接,在Windows上,可以通过“远程桌面连接”工具;在Mac上,可以使用Microsoft Remote Desktop应用。
2. 文件传输
使用SCP命令:SCP(Secure Copy Protocol)是一种基于SSH的文件传输协议,以下是基本的SCP命令格式:
scp local_file user@server:/path/to/remote/directory
使用FTP:你也可以设置一个FTP服务器来进行文件传输,常见的FTP软件有FileZilla和ProFTPD。
3. 管理进程
查看进程:使用ps
命令可以查看当前运行的进程列表:
ps aux
终止进程:使用kill
命令可以终止指定的进程:
kill process_id
雷霆服务器的性能优化
1. 内存管理
监控内存使用情况:使用free -m
命令可以查看当前的内存使用情况:
free -m
释放缓存:使用echo 3 > /proc/sys/vm/drop_caches
可以释放页面缓存、目录项和inode缓存。
2. CPU管理
监控CPU使用情况:使用top
命令可以实时查看CPU的使用情况:
top
调整进程优先级:使用nice
和renice
命令可以调整进程的优先级,从而影响其对CPU资源的占用,提高一个进程的优先级:
nice -n -10 command
3. 磁盘I/O优化
监控磁盘I/O:使用iostat
命令可以查看磁盘I/O的统计信息:
iostat -xz 1
调整I/O调度器:使用echo
命令可以临时更改I/O调度算法,例如切换到deadline调度器:
echo deadline > /sys/block/sda/queue/scheduler
常见问题及解决方法
Q1: SSH连接超时怎么办?
A1: 如果SSH连接超时,可以尝试以下方法解决:
1、检查网络连接是否正常。
2、确保SSH服务在服务器端已启动并正在**正确的端口。
3、检查防火墙设置,确保SSH端口(默认22)未被阻止。
4、增加SSH客户端的超时时间,
ssh -o ConnectTimeout=60 username@server_ip
Q2: 如何自动挂载网络存储?
A2: 自动挂载网络存储可以通过编辑/etc/fstab
文件来实现,步骤如下:
1、打开/etc/fstab
文件:
sudo nano /etc/fstab
2、添加挂载条目,
//server/share /mnt/share cifs username=user,password=pass 0 0
3、保存文件并退出编辑器。
4、运行mount -a
命令来测试新的挂载配置。
5、如果一切正常,系统将在启动时自动挂载该网络存储。
相关问题与解答
Q1: 如何在雷霆服务器上安装软件包?
A1: 在雷霆服务器上安装软件包通常使用包管理器,如apt
(Debian/Ubuntu)或yum
(CentOS/RHEL),以安装curl
为例,可以使用以下命令:
Debian/Ubuntusudo apt updatesudo apt install curlCentOS/RHELsudo yum install curl
Q2: 如何查看雷霆服务器的硬件信息?
A2: 你可以使用多种命令来查看雷霆服务器的硬件信息,以下是一些常用命令:
查看CPU信息lscpu查看内存信息cat /proc/meminfo查看硬盘信息l***lkdf -h查看网卡信息ifconfigip a
上一篇:竞价网址的实战经验分享!